Today, the countdown has started for 19 designated very large online platforms and search engines (having more than 45 million monthly active users in the EU) to fully comply with the special obligations that the Digital Services Act imposes on them.
With a clear deadline to comply: 25 August 2023.
4 months from today’s designation, they will not be able to act as if they were “too big to care”.
